    Detection of Lumpy Skin Disease Virus in Transhipped Through Merak Port and The Impact of its Spread

    Research to detect the presence of Lumpy Skin Disease Virus (LSDV) was carried out in the work area of the Banten Animal, Fish and Plant Quarantine Center (BBKHIT). Sampling for LSDV detection was taken from cattle that were being transported both in and out of Merak Port. The aim of this research is to detect the presence of LSDV both clinically and in laboratory examinations at Merak Port and estimate the impact of its spread. 152 mouth and nose swab samples were taken, then a quantitative real time PCR (qPCR) test was carried out. The results of the study showed that there were no clinical symptoms observed in the trafficked cattle, however there were 2 positive samples for LSD by molecular testing using qPCR. These results can be said to be subclinically infected cattle. Positive samples came from cattle trafficked from Sumbawa Regency and Central Lampung Regency with respective Ct values of 27.71 and 28.88. Estimates of the impact of the spread of LSDV were carried out based on the categories of breeding cattle and beef cattle. The impact of the spread of LSDV is estimated to be more dangerous and will occur in breeding cattle because of their long lifespan during the rearing process. This means that the LSD virus can continue to spread to other cows rather than cows that are immediately slaughtered.

    PENGARUH EKSTRAK KEMANGI (Ocimum sanctum) TERHADAP KEMAMPUAN BELAJAR DAN MEMORI: JUMLAH SARAF NITRERJIK DI SUBIKULUM HIPOKAMPUS TIKUS (Rattus norvegicus)

    Degradation of cognitive ability such as memory and learning knows adays are increasing progressively increasing and occurs in various age groups, not only in old age but also at the productive age. Holy basil (Ocimum sanctum) is a known herb which can improve cognitive ability. Cognitive abilities are controlled by hippocampus. Hippocampus consist of 3 there are dentate gyrus, hippocampus proper, and subiculum. One of the indication of cognitive ability improvement can be evaluated from neurotransmitter, one of which is Nitric Oxide (NO). The aim of research was to determine the influence of holy basil extract agains of cognitive ability which is evaluated from the number of nitrergic neurons on subiculum. Nine male rats (Rattus norvegicus) 4 weeks of age used, 50-60 g from Unit Development of Animal Laboratory of UGM was used on tihs research. Extract of holy basil (40 mg/kg BW) was given every day per-oral. At 2, 6, and 8 weeks of treatment 3 rats were anaesthetized using ketamine and xylazine (100 mg/kg and 10 mg/kg), perfused intracardiacally by Nacl 0.9% continued with phosphate buffer formalin 10%. The brain was taked out and processed for cryostat section 20μm, n stained by hematoxylin Eosin (HE) and Nicotinamide Adenine Dinucleotide Phosphate-Diaphorase (NADPH-d) method. Nitrergic neurons on subiculum has pyramidal shape which is have positive reaction of blue chromatic and the nucleus was not stained.
